<h3>What is the mean?</h3>
The mean of a data-set is given by the <u>sum of all observations in the data-set divided by the number of observations</u>.
In this problem, the 8 observations are given by:
3.6 1.8 1.5 3.5 3.1 5.4 2.8 4.5
Hence the mean is given by:
M = (3.6 + 1.8 + 1.5 + 3.5 + 3.1 + 5.4 + 2.8 + 4.5)/8 = 3.275.

Answer:
Cos <B = 3/5
Step-by-step explanation:
Find the diagram attached
From the diagram, we have;
Hypotenuse BC = 80
Opposite to <B = AC =64
Adjacent AB = 48
According to SOH CAH TOA identity
Cos theta = adjacent/hypotenuse
Cos<B = AB/BC
Cos <B = 48/80
Express in its simplest form
Cos <B = (16*3)/(16*5)
Cos <B = 3/5
Hence the ratio of cos<B in its simplest form is 3/5
